Another day, another wacky item from Japan. This time, it’s Coca-Cola Frozen, and this product is exactly as it sounds…a version of the drink that turns to slush when placed in the freezer. In addition to the lemon twist, the concoction comes in a squeezable pouch, and the formula reportedly took 8-years to develop from scratch.
Despite how it looks, keeping Coca-Cola flavors in frozen packet form is much harder than you’d think. Why? Well, just try freezing Coca-Cola yourself in a freezer and see how it comes out. More than likely, you’ll end up with a beverage that has frozen solid.
